Lithuania - Export of Partly or Wholly Hydrogenated Vegetable Fats and Oils

Since 2014, Lithuania Export of Partly or Wholly Hydrogenated Vegetable Fats and Oils was down by 13.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 20 among other countries in Export of Partly or Wholly Hydrogenated Vegetable Fats and Oils at €1,289,863. Lithuania is overtaken by Latvia, which was number 19 at €1,469,749 and is followed by Estonia at €1,039,214. Netherlands lead the ranking with €287,464,057.12 in 2019, an increase of 1.6% versus 2018. Germany, Sweden and Spain resp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Austria recorded the best 5 years average growth at +41.8% per year, while Latvia witnessed the worst performance at -24.1% per year.
